Borgopetra

Born in the 18th century and the heart of numerous agricultural activities, lovingly restored, Borgopetra is open to hospitality: it consists of various spaces divided into several housing units and many outdoor areas: gardens, a gym, vegetable gardens, a common area with a ping pong table and billiards. The structure welcomes travelers in various spaces arranged around the inner courtyard and offers houses of different sizes, all tastefully furnished with family furniture and finds from around the world: two apartments of over 100 sqm that can accommodate up to 6 people, with kitchen, private services, and exclusive outdoor spaces, and two small suites that can accommodate up to 3 people, also with kitchen, private services, and outdoor spaces. The guest houses open onto a square courtyard. The lava stone windows overlook the vegetable garden and the garden.

The structure and hospitality

The structure consists of various spaces arranged around the inner courtyard and divided into several housing units. The lava stone doors and windows of Borgopetra’s suites overlook the large square courtyard paved with terracotta tiles, the “open heart” of the house. Among the century-old oleanders thrives a collection of cacti and succulents, and summer nights are scented with jasmine.
From the two terraces, you can see Mount Etna to the north and, beyond the roofs of old Mascalucia, Catania and the sea to the south.

Between the walnut and mulberry trees, the apricot and orange trees, the palm and pepper trees, the plum tree, and the pergola of ancient grapes, the old orchard hosts the pool and the large theater building. In the northern and western land strips, the vegetable garden produces small forests of broccoli and lettuce in winter, fava beans in spring, tomatoes, eggplants, and zucchini in summer. Here and there are citrus trees and many aromatic herbs that guests can find in the kitchens of the houses. To the south, in the small garden within the ancient walls of the Casa del Barone, myrtle, mint, sage, and thyme mix with flowering plants in all seasons.
